Arachis hypogaea
This peanut came our way via Michael Lordon from the Organic Seed Alliance. Michael found this peanut at the Madison Wisconsin farmers market and was impressed that someone was able to grow peanuts for the market given the short season up North. Beautiful yellow flowers with three to four peanuts per shell.
Direct seed or transplant into the garden after all danger of frost has passed. Peanuts will need full sun and well-draining soil. Water well to ensure good germination. Once germinated, they will need at least an inch of water per week. When they’re ready for harvest, the plant will turn yellow and begin to wilt. Annual.
